summ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orNarrat2020-01-11 14:18:13 +0100
committerNarrat2020-01-11 14:18:13 +0100
commit39f42c5117b14922831e21569aecc4dd72ebfce1 (patch)
tree9f0542c5f02e074c236b2d2d3eb110354abe6335
parentd9eaa26cb04396a1d2fd2f4d3692e7bb3a6afea5 (diff)
downloadaur-39f42c5117b14922831e21569aecc4dd72ebfce1.tar.gz
Update to 1.10
Bump ghostpdl version to 9.22. Mentioned in the README as the highest tested version. Removed the || return 1 statements, as those are unnecessary.
-rw-r--r--.SRCINFO16
-rw-r--r--PKGBUILD39
-rw-r--r--PKGBUILD.sig11
3 files changed, 29 insertions, 37 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 0b9cf2815090..b978a3de204c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,9 +1,7 @@
-# Generated by mksrcinfo v8
-# Mon May 30 11:40:41 UTC 2016
pkgbase = gsdjvu
pkgdesc = Very efficient way of converting PostScript and PDF documents into DjVu
- pkgver = 1.9
- pkgrel = 2
+ pkgver = 1.10
+ pkgrel = 1
url = http://djvu.sourceforge.net/gsdjvu.html
arch = i686
arch = x86_64
@@ -13,15 +11,15 @@ pkgbase = gsdjvu
depends = libpng12>=1.2.6
depends = zlib>=1.2.1
optdepends = djvulibre
- noextract = ghostscript-9.18.tar.bz2
+ noextract = ghostscript-9.22.tar.bz2
noextract = ghostscript-fonts-std-8.11.tar.gz
options = !libtool
options = !makeflags
- source = http://downloads.sourceforge.net/sourceforge/djvu/gsdjvu-1.9.tar.gz
- source = http://downloads.ghostscript.com/public/old-gs-releases/ghostscript-9.18.tar.bz2
+ source = http://downloads.sourceforge.net/sourceforge/djvu/gsdjvu-1.10.tar.gz
+ source = https://github.com/ArtifexSoftware/ghostpdl-downloads/releases/download/gs922/ghostpdl-9.22.tar.gz
source = http://downloads.sourceforge.net/ghostscript/ghostscript-fonts-std-8.11.tar.gz
- sha1sums = f98eed58ecc161ade57a5c067277b2e9d631b2b3
- sha1sums = 388fea50a38e422a4c6ff27c184491bf5ecb96e1
+ sha1sums = 0ce418b0a06c807c2010458694a09a9fbf847a0b
+ sha1sums = 59ac602416468dca63ddca5154cd51e5116b3481
sha1sums = 2a7198e8178b2e7dba87cb5794da515200b568f5
pkgname = gsdjvu
diff --git a/PKGBUILD b/PKGBUILD
index acf15b6f9e04..528c8d4e17d2 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,10 +2,10 @@
# Contributor: AndyRTR <andyrtr@archlinux.org>
pkgname=gsdjvu
-pkgver=1.9
-_gsver=9.18
+pkgver=1.10
+_gsver=9.22
_fontsver=8.11
-pkgrel=2
+pkgrel=1
pkgdesc="Very efficient way of converting PostScript and PDF documents into DjVu"
arch=(i686 x86_64)
# This program mixes GPL and CPL licensed codes, so the binaries are not redistributable.
@@ -14,33 +14,38 @@ depends=('libcups>=1.3.9-3' 'cairo' 'libpng12>=1.2.6' 'zlib>=1.2.1')
optdepends=('djvulibre') # for the djvudigital converter
url="http://djvu.sourceforge.net/gsdjvu.html"
source=("http://downloads.sourceforge.net/sourceforge/djvu/gsdjvu-${pkgver}.tar.gz"
- "http://downloads.ghostscript.com/public/old-gs-releases/ghostscript-${_gsver}.tar.bz2"
- "http://downloads.sourceforge.net/ghostscript/ghostscript-fonts-std-${_fontsver}.tar.gz" )
+ "https://github.com/ArtifexSoftware/ghostpdl-downloads/releases/download/gs${_gsver/./}/ghostpdl-${_gsver}.tar.gz"
+ "http://downloads.sourceforge.net/ghostscript/ghostscript-fonts-std-${_fontsver}.tar.gz")
noextract=("ghostscript-${_gsver}.tar.bz2"
"ghostscript-fonts-std-${_fontsver}.tar.gz")
options=('!libtool' '!makeflags')
-sha1sums=('f98eed58ecc161ade57a5c067277b2e9d631b2b3'
- '388fea50a38e422a4c6ff27c184491bf5ecb96e1'
+sha1sums=('0ce418b0a06c807c2010458694a09a9fbf847a0b'
+ '59ac602416468dca63ddca5154cd51e5116b3481'
'2a7198e8178b2e7dba87cb5794da515200b568f5')
-build() {
+
+prepare() {
cd "$pkgname-$pkgver"
mkdir -p BUILD
- ln -sf "$srcdir/ghostscript-${_gsver}.tar.bz2" BUILD
+ ln -sf "$srcdir/ghostpdl-${_gsver}.tar.gz" BUILD
ln -sf "$srcdir/ghostscript-fonts-std-${_fontsver}.tar.gz" BUILD
+}
+
+build() {
+ cd "$pkgname-$pkgver"
- echo -e 'YES\n\n' | "$srcdir/gsdjvu-$pkgver/build-gsdjvu" || return 1
+ echo -e 'YES\n\n' | "$srcdir/gsdjvu-$pkgver/build-gsdjvu"
}
package() {
cd "$pkgname-$pkgver"
- install -dm755 "$pkgdir/usr/lib" || return 1
- cp -a BUILD/INST/gsdjvu "$pkgdir/usr/lib" || return 1
- install -dm755 "$pkgdir/usr/bin" || return 1
- ln -s "/usr/lib/gsdjvu/gsdjvu" "$pkgdir/usr/bin/gsdjvu" || return 1
- sed -i -e 's,/usr/bin/gs,/usr/lib/gsdjvu/bin/gs,' "$pkgdir/usr/lib/gsdjvu/gsdjvu" || return 1
- install -dm755 "$pkgdir/usr/share/licenses/$pkgname" || return 1
- install -m644 COPYING* "$pkgdir/usr/share/licenses/$pkgname" || return 1
+ install -dm755 "$pkgdir/usr/lib"
+ cp -a BUILD/INST/gsdjvu "$pkgdir/usr/lib"
+ install -dm755 "$pkgdir/usr/bin"
+ ln -s "/usr/lib/gsdjvu/gsdjvu" "$pkgdir/usr/bin/gsdjvu"
+ sed -i -e 's,/usr/bin/gs,/usr/lib/gsdjvu/bin/gs,' "$pkgdir/usr/lib/gsdjvu/gsdjvu"
+ install -dm755 "$pkgdir/usr/share/licenses/$pkgname"
+ install -m644 COPYING* "$pkgdir/usr/share/licenses/$pkgname"
}
diff --git a/PKGBUILD.sig b/PKGBUILD.sig
deleted file mode 100644
index 9be995d2fc69..000000000000
--- a/PKGBUILD.sig
+++ /dev/null
@@ -1,11 +0,0 @@
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2
-
-iQEcBAABCAAGBQJXTCakAAoJECSyfCdcYmjT2SQH/AxgA8BGe/aXYqOx5trjLGlt
-Nms4J/QgNn8jAh4JJ28mJ5S7w6MgaM1lE8iMY+qmdB2lg+UbjfwuaZ2r4pl29pOP
-1gkz9/4oUYJ9ByRZyAqA5PunwO6wMiTyAD/9lqJcCxYRM7gHj+HHV1sQ6TvZ/8p9
-yfknh1Eb+nL8TRcA4H9DNfPGy4JVyghh1jLpMLmfPkxtklBzipQpAafSTsqNubdl
-+M//mwnAQGAwNoE/09RlyvHFkXHaycNEk+nCDwvoYaa8jtFTfNSP67an13EubFeI
-4BwnqwMIjhtqy+hWeZfXNlyHY694tB+GyfYuJ/eGrSyqvfMWaENF0PDL3+CSQ1c=
-=aJFZ
------END PGP SIGNATURE-----